Welcome
This website has been designed to enable ex and serving Communications Branch Personnel of the Royal New Zealand Navy to maintain contact with fellow Communicators and to advise members of items of interest as they arise.
We would especially invite serving members of the Communictions Branch to come and visit the site and to access the knowledge of the retired members in any communications projects which they may be assigned. Remember there is years of experience available on tap and all you have to do is ask.

Navy Weekend 1950 and the Rock
This image is of the 15th Ordinary Seamen and 9th Ordinary Telegraphists marching through Auckland on Navy Weekend 1950. The Officer in charge is Lt “Teddy” Thorne (later Rear Admiral) O/Tel Rob Thompson hoisting the White Ensign at Divisions. HMNZS … Continue reading
